Hey, I've been wanting to get into C++ for a while now and lately I've searching for help on how to set up my Vista machine for C++ development.

 

I downloaded Visual C++, but it seems like a bunch of horse manure. I used to use Bloodshed before, but unfortunately, it doesn't seem to "do Vista".

 

Does anyone have any idea how I could set up a development environment for C++ on Vista?

 

Thanks

Visual C++ Express is an awesome choice. It should work with Vista.

 

Optionally, if you really can't get it, I recommend you to download NetBeans. It is free and you can install C++, Java, and probably other compilers to it. Personally I don't use it, but for what I have seen and been told, it seems like it is really good.

I've got it working. The problem was that I didn't download the Dev Bloodshed version that included Mingw, i.e. I clicked the wrong link like a douche. When I downloaded version that included Mingw, Visual C++ started working too. So now I have two working IDEs. :)
